I have experience with Python and Java, and I'm looking to dive into C++. Could anyone share recommendations for learning resources? I'm open to videos, books, or any other useful tips to get started!
3 Answers
The Cherno on YouTube has an awesome C++ series that was really beneficial for me. I highly recommend checking it out!
If you’re coming from Python and Java, the main thing you’ll need to adjust to is C++'s manual memory management. Unlike those languages, you'll have to manage memory manually, which is a big shift. One fantastic resource is learncpp.com, which is well-respected for its clarity and modern approach. Read it in order—it'll really solidify your knowledge. For a visual learning experience, The Cherno's YouTube series is great too. Make sure to code along while watching!
